Ok, you know the ugly grey cables that connect the front "utilities" (USB, firewire, sound ports, etc.) to the motherboard? Yeah, well, my 75G2 evidently doesn't want to produce sound without those cables in there. Anyone know any "hacks" to fix this (besides a $70 sound card), just so I can look inside my case and find no cables running through the middle of it? Also, anyone know of a BIOS/third party software where you can adjust the FSB/RAM divider, so I can get it off this horrendous 4:5? Thanks.
 
My desktop MB will do kind of the same thing. Either I have to have a front port audio connection hooked up, or (by default) it has a set of jumpers to short out those pins. I think a headphone jack automaticly shorts out it's connectors without a plug in the jack.

Find some jumpers from an old modem or motherboard and jump each of the audio pins on the motherboard header.
